GET odds-by-tournaments
Recupera le quote per tutti gli incontri in un torneo specificato.
Endpoint
GET /v4/odds-by-tournamentsParametri della richiesta
- tournamentIds*
(string)— Un elenco di ID torneo separati da virgola. - bookmaker
(string)— (Opzionale) Lo slug del bookmaker da cui restituire le quote. - verbosity
(number)— (Opzionale) Il livello di verbosità per controllare il dettaglio della risposta. - oddsFormat
(string)— (Opzionale) Il formato delle quote nella risposta (ad es.decimal,american).
Esempio di richiesta
GET /v4/odds-by-tournaments?tournamentIds=17Esempio di risposta
[
{
"fixtureId": "id1000001761300517",
"participant1Id": 3,
"participant2Id": 17,
"sportId": 10,
"tournamentId": 17,
"seasonId": null,
"externalProviders": {
"betradarId": 61300517,
"mollybetId": null,
"opticoddsId": null,
"lsportsId": null,
"txoddsId": null,
"sofascoreId": null,
"betgeniusId": 12482853,
"flashscoreId": null,
"pinnacleId": 1610924789,
"oddinId": null
},
"statusId": null,
"hasOdds": true,
"startTime": "2025-08-16T16:30:00.000Z",
"trueStartTime": null,
"trueEndTime": null,
"updatedAt": "2025-07-14T20:06:02.074Z",
"participant1Name": "Wolverhampton Wanderers",
"participant2Name": "Manchester City",
"sportName": "Soccer",
"tournamentSlug": "premier-league",
"categorySlug": "england",
"categoryName": "England",
"tournamentName": "Premier League",
"bookmakerOdds": {
"pinnacle": {
"bookmakerFixtureId": "1610924789",
"fixturePath": "https://www.pinnacle.com/en/e/e/e/1610924789/#all",
"bookmakerIsActive": true,
"markets": {
"101": {
"bookmakerMarketId": "line/29/1980/3180242530/0/moneyline",
"outcomes": {
"101": {
"players": {
"0": {
"price": 5.84,
"limit": 250,
"active": true,
"changedAt": "2025-07-17T10:45:56.606Z",
"playerId": 0,
"bookmakerOutcomeId": "home"
}
}
},
"102": {
"players": {
"0": {
"price": 4.76,
"limit": 250,
"active": true,
"changedAt": "2025-07-17T10:45:56.606Z",
"playerId": 0,
"bookmakerOutcomeId": "draw"
}
}
},
"103": {
"players": {
"0": {
"price": 1.454,
"limit": 550.66,
"active": true,
"changedAt": "2025-07-17T10:45:56.606Z",
"playerId": 0,
"bookmakerOutcomeId": "away"
}
}
}
}
}
}
}
}
}
]Risposta (200 OK)
In caso di richiesta andata a buon fine, il server risponde con un codice di stato 200 e restituisce un oggetto JSON contenente gli incontri con le rispettive quote.
- fixtureId
(string)— L’identificatore univoco dell’incontro per il quale recuperare i punteggi. - sportId
(number)— L’identificatore univoco dello sport. Questo ID deve corrispondere a uno sport esistente. - tournamentId
(string)— L’identificatore univoco del torneo. Questo ID deve corrispondere a un torneo esistente. - startTime
(string)— Orario di inizio in formato ISO 8601. - participant1Name
(string)— Il nome del primo partecipante (nella lingua richiesta). - participant2Name
(string)— Il nome del secondo partecipante (nella lingua richiesta). - bookmakerOdds
(object)— Quote raggruppate per slug del bookmaker:- bookmakerFixtureId
(string)— ID univoco dell’incontro usato dal bookmaker. - fixturePath
(string)— Link alla pagina di scommessa del bookmaker per l’incontro. - bookmakerIsActive
(boolean)— Indica se il bookmaker sta attualmente offrendo quote per questo incontro. - markets
(object)— Oggetto che contiene ID mercato come chiavi e i relativi dati di mercato:- bookmakerMarketId
(string)— ID mercato interno o percorso usato dal bookmaker. - outcomes
(object)— Mappa degli ID esito verso i relativi dati di esito. Ogni oggetto esito include prezzi a livello giocatore:- players
(object)— Ogni esito è collegato a uno o più giocatori per cui sono offerte quote.:- price
(number)— Il prezzo (quota) offerto. - limit
(number)— La puntata massima consentita per quella quota. - active
(boolean)— Indica se la quota è attualmente attiva. - changedAt
(string)— Timestamp dell’ultima modifica della quota. - playerId
(number)— ID del giocatore (di solito0). - bookmakerOutcomeId
(string)— Etichetta dell’esito lato bookmaker.
- price
- players
- bookmakerMarketId
- bookmakerFixtureId
Note
- Cooldown dell’endpoint: 1000ms
Pagina precedenteGET odds
Pagina successivaGET historical_odds
